The fifth annual MICROHOME architecture competition is part of the Buildner’s Small Scale Architecture Appreciation Movement, which hopes to highlight the fact that bigger isn’t always better. With great design and innovative thinking, small-scale architecture could change how this and the next generation view the residential property.

Additionally, for the MICROHOME / Edition No 5 architecture competition, participants are invited to submit their designs for a micro-home – an off-grid modular structure that would accommodate a hypothetical young professional couple (which will be used as an example of family size throughout the competition series). Moreover, the only requirement is that the structure’s total floor area does not exceed 25 m2; beyond that, participants are encouraged to be as creative as possible.

Furthermore, participants are encouraged to rethink spatial organization and incorporate unique aesthetics, new technologies, and innovative materials that will make the micro home an entirely new form of architecture.

As there is no specified competition site, project designs can be set within any hypothetical site of any size, in either a city or countryside location anywhere in the world. Moreover, the jury will favor sustainable designs and those projects that look to solve economic, social, and cultural problems through the establishment of new architectural methods.​

PRIZES

There will be 3 winning proposals, 2 special award recipients, and 6 honorable mentions. Buildner (formerly Bee Breeders) will award a total of 7,000 € in prize money to competition winners as follows:

1st Prize – 3,000 €
2nd Prize – 1,500 €
3rd Prize – 1,000 €
+ 6 honorable mentions

Buildner Student Award – 1000 € + 50 € gift card at ARCHHIVE BOOKS
Buildner Sustainability Award – 500 €

COMPETITION SCHEDULE

Early Bird Registration: MAY 2 – JULY 5
Advance Registration: JULY 6 – SEPTEMBER 7
Last Minute Registration: SEPTEMBER 8 – NOVEMBER 3

Final registration deadline: NOVEMBER 3, 2022
Closing date for submission: DECEMBER 2, 2022 (11:59 p.m. GMT)
Announcement of the winners: JANUARY 18, 2023
